Pantene Pro V Council of Stylists
April 30, 2008 by Sasha Manuel
Filed under Beauty
Part of the programme of the Pantene Dare to Get Wet Event last Monday night, 28 April 2008 was the presentation of their Council of Stylists to the media and the rest of the public. Included are such luminaries in the styling world as (pictured above, left to right) Rose Velasco and Jude Hipolito of Univers Phyto Salon by Kaizen, Jing Monis of Propaganda, Celeste Tuviera of Symmetria, Henri Calayag of Henri Calayag Salon, Louis Kee of Razzle Dazzle, and Victor Ortega of Emphasis.
